Charges after Melbourne supermarket attack

A homeless man has been charged for allegedly punching a stranger outside a supermarket in Melbourne's north.

The 18-year-old victim was allegedly assaulted outside a supermarket on the corner of West and Geum streets at Hadfield on June 29, Victoria Police said.

He was taken to hospital with a broken jaw and other serious injuries.

A 20-year-old man of no fixed address was arrested at a shopping centre in Preston on Friday.

He was charged with intentionally cause serious injury and theft of motor vehicle and is expected to face Melbourne Magistrates' Court on Saturday.
